Global Ocean is a leading provider of specialised marine equipment and services to the aquaculture and marine sectors. Our fleet includes diesel generators, compressors, oxygen generation systems, pumps, vessels, and associated marine plant operating throughout Australia.
We are seeking a motivated and reliable Trade Assistant to support our maintenance team in servicing, repairing, and preparing equipment for deployment. This is an excellent opportunity to build your skills while working alongside experienced mechanics and marine industry professionals.
About the Role
Reporting to the Leading Hand and Service Manager, you will assist with workshop and field maintenance activities, equipment preparation, and general operational support.
This is a hands-on role suited to someone who enjoys working with machinery, tools, and equipment and is looking to develop a long-term career in the mechanical or marine industries.
Key Responsibilities
Assist Mechanics and Leading Hands with servicing, maintenance, and repairs.
Support the inspection and preparation of generators, compressors, oxygen generators, pumps, and associated equipment.
Assist with equipment mobilisation and demobilisation activities.
Clean, maintain, and organise workshop facilities, tools, and equipment.
Load and unload equipment, parts, and consumables.
Assist with fault finding, component replacement, and routine maintenance tasks.
Complete basic maintenance activities under supervision.
Support stock control and inventory management.
Maintain accurate maintenance records and service documentation.
Ensure all work is carried out safely and in accordance with company procedures.
